Summary
This task is divided into two activities:
a) Specification of a formal development demonstrator prototype.
The specification of the formal development demonstrator will be based on the use case developed in Shift2Rail-(X2RAIL-2): 5.4.1 Development of Systems with standardized interfaces and it will consist in the identification of the overall process to be followed for the formal analysis and establishing the criteria for suitability of supporting tools.
In particular, the definition of the architecture of the formal development demonstrator will include the choice of appropriate formal methods and tools to be integrated taking into account the results produced by current projects in SHIFT2RAIL: ASTRail, X2RAIL-2. Moreover, in this activity we will identify the tools for the description in standard interfaces (e.g. SysML) of the railway subsystem. (D2.1).
b) Formal development demonstrator prototype.
A detailed description of the process and framework constituting the demonstrator prototype will be released in (D2.2i, first draft). This description will show, in particular, how all the identified components will be integrated and used. This first release of the prototype will be validated on a selected portion of the railway signalling subsystem defined in T2.2.
The detailed description of the process and the framework constituting the demonstrator prototype will be finalised in (D2.2f, final release), taking into account the results of the experimentation of the prototype done in Task 2.3.
CNR will lead the task providing the specification and the formal development of the demonstrator prototype. ARD will contribute in the activity, ensuring the link with ASTRail. SIRTI will ensure the necessary link with the outcome of X2RAIL-2 and will lead the collaboration with the complementary project X2RAIL-3 through at least one collaboration meeting.
More information & hyperlinks